Hitler Arrested

It is being reported that the former president of Iran, Mahmoud Ahmadinejad, has been arrested for inciting unrest against the government. This is the man that just a few years ago many neoconservatives, some conservative Christians, and other assorted defenders of the U.S. empire equated with Hitler.


3:29 pm on January 7, 2018